At its core, RSA is a type of cryptography:
Select one:
a Onetime pad, where a unique key is used for each message, rendering it unbreakable.
b Stream cipher, encrypting the message bit by bit with a keystream.
c Asymmetric key, where different keys are used for encryption and decryption.
d Symmetric key, where both parties use the same key for encryption and decryption.
